Difference between daily ritual and routine

The difference between a daily ritual and a routine, how do you think about it. It's how you perceive your actions. Are they mundane chores that just need to be completed, or activities that bring meaning, learning, or joy into your life? It's all about your mindset. A daily routine is a series of tasks that are completed every day in the same order. For example, getting up and going to work, stacking the dishwasher, brushing your teeth and getting the kids ready for school. The mode can feel mundane and boring because that's what you have to do. You can complete procedures on autopilot. They may be effective, but the routines are not necessarily motivating or enjoyable. They are seen as a chore. The daily ritual is similar to the daily routine, as they are also a series of tasks that are performed in the same order. But the daily ritual is different in its intent. Daily rituals make sense of practice and are intrinsically motivated. A daily ritual can provide energy and pleasure along with efficiency and structure. 2. Mindfulness

Mindfulness is the basic human ability to be fully present and aware of where we are and what we are doing. This helps us not to be overly reactive or overwhelmed by what is happening around us. When we remember, we reduce stress, increase productivity, gain insight and awareness through observation of our own minds, and increase our focus on others' well-being. Practical advice on how to be attentive, learn 7 ways to train yourself to be more attentive. There are also some great apps to help you remember every day. We can turn daily routines into everyday rituals by applying the technique of concentration. For example, how many of us eat on the go, in the car, between meetings? Apply mindfulness techniques to food, paying attention to many different aspects of nutrition: taste, temperature, and texture. Also pay attention to the physical sensations of eating: chewing, swallowing, and even digesting. Applying mindfulness to eating can help you enjoy your meal more. This will help you eat more slowly and therefore eat less because you are more observant when you feel full. Mindfulness of food will be able to reduce food intake and improve taste, because you are more likely to savor every bite and feel more satisfied.
